Rick/David,
My understanding of the Observers/Gunners seat is that it went through several evolutions during the development of the the Lynx. The seat that you have Rick is the first version and the second drawing is of the later version. I was able to replicate the raising/lower mechanism, but the seat base pan and back was too much of a challenge. I elected to use the Driver's seat which uses a conventional CMP seat mounted on a unique raising/lowering mechanism as a model for my Observers/Gunners seat. Peter ob seat1 (2).jpg obseat2 (2).jpg |
